Becoming Buddha Heruka: Sublime Compassion & Bliss
This retreat on The Yoga of Buddha Heruka gives newer people the opportunity to taste Tantric meditation and gives more experienced practitioners an opportunity to go more deeply into their own practice.
Healing & Prolonging Life: Receiving Blessings of Buddha Amitayus
Amitayus means immeasurable life span. When we open our heart to Buddha Amitayus' blessings, he will help us increase our wisdom, our merit and, most importantly, he will help us protect our most precious possession -- our life.

The Center
KMCSF was the first Kadampa Center established in the USA since 1991. In our peaceful city sanctuary, Buddha's teachings are presented in an accessible manner that can easily be integrated into busy modern life. Our teachings are based on the books of the modern day meditation master and Buddhist teacher Venerable Geshe Kelsang Gyatso Rinpoche. We now offer online streaming.
